We are hiring a Peer Support Specialist (PSS) for our growing team!  As a Peer Support Specialist we offer you the opportunity to work in a dynamic, team-oriented, environment helping individuals overcome substance abuse addiction. In this role you will be part of a multi-functioning team that works interdependently with other departments in the organization.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Hold peer support groups for the clients of the center
  • Maintain confidentiality and comply with company, state, federal and HIPAA rules and regulations
  • Charting duties for insurance purposes
  • Maintain a positive, professional attitude toward clients, staff and volunteers
  • Handle crisis situations in a calm supportive manner
  • Complete drug screening when needed
  • Create a safe and healthy environment for clients
  • Perform Residential Staff duties as needed

The above is intended to be a general outline of job duties and not a complete list.

Key Experience and Education Needed:

  • Must be Peer Support Certified by the state of Kentucky. 
  • High school graduate or GED preferred
  • Valid driver's license

Other Qualifications to be Considered:

  • Self motivated
  • Availability to work some evening, overnight and/or weekend shifts
  • Good communication skills
  • Ability to meet deadlines and stay on schedule
  • Ability to enforce program requirements
  • Problem solving abilities
  • Basic computer skills
